2027 Bentley Supersports Anthracite
By Lorenzo Bianchi August 22, 2026
This configured Bentley Supersports in the Nightfall Design Theme is priced at €352,941, one of five bespoke themes — Nightfall, Meteorite, Skies, Daybreak and Snowstorm — crafted by Bentley's design team.
Nightfall pairs Anthracite paintwork, carbon-fibre exterior styling and blackware trim with 22-inch Supersports Forged Alloy Wheels finished in Gloss Black and Bright Machined.
The cabin uses a tri-tone Camel, Beluga and Bronze leather scheme with High Gloss Carbon Fibre fascias, and this build adds the Supersports Design Theme Level 1 package and Pirelli P Zero Trofeo RS tyres as options.

Exterior Design and Finish
The defining elements are Anthracite paintwork (spelled "Antharacite" in Bentley's own document, likely a typo), carbon-fibre styling pieces, and blackware trim running across the body. Wheels are 22-inch Supersports Forged Alloys, finished in Gloss Black with a Bright Machined face — the kind of detail that reads as sportier and more purposeful than a standard polished alloy.

Interior Space and Technology
Inside, the tri-tone scheme mixes Camel, Beluga and Bronze leather with High Gloss Carbon Fibre fascias and door waistrails, tied together with contrast stitching and Bronze accents.

Practical Usability and Options
Two priced options are itemised for this specific build: the Supersports Design Theme – Level 1 package at €30,840 (basic, pre-tax) and Pirelli P Zero Trofeo RS tyres at €2,500 (basic, pre-tax), on top of the car's total price of €352,941. Bentley doesn't break down what's standard versus optional beyond that, so it's unclear how much of the final figure reflects the base Supersports versus this particular configuration.
